首页 > 编程语言
qq聊天机器人 群发工具 (java版) (二)
上一篇介绍了如何借用webqq协议登陆qq,这一篇主要讲下如何实现群发消息。就目前我所知的消息类型有3种,分别是好友消息,群消息以及临时会话消息(这个一般是往群组成员群发)。3种消息分别对应3种方法(3个post方法),下面依次介绍。 1.群发好友消息 要想群发好友消息,首先要获取消息对象,也即好友列表。只有获取了每个QQ好友的标识,才知道往谁去发消息。所以,群发的第一步其实就是获取对象,这里...
分类:编程语言   时间:2015-05-31 20:12:23    收藏:0  评论:0  赞:0  阅读:344
百度3道算法题求解
百度3道算法题求解...
分类:编程语言   时间:2015-05-31 20:11:03    收藏:0  评论:0  赞:0  阅读:316
[C/C++标准库]_[初级]_[map的查找函数分析]
场景: 1. map在查找非数值索引(数值非重复索引可以使用vector)的对象时是高效率的,因为用的红黑树的实现,查找和插入都是logarithmic time 效率很高. 2.map可以说是很实用的数据结构. 3.使用multimap可以存储重复key,使用场景就是1对多的情况,比如一个联系人对应多个分组....
分类:编程语言   时间:2015-05-31 20:10:53    收藏:0  评论:0  赞:0  阅读:283
java
1java语言的特点:       一种面向对象的语言,       一种平台无关的语言,提供程序运行的解释环境,       一种健壮的语言,吸收的C/C++语言的优点,但去掉了其影响程序健壮性的部分(如:指针、内存的申请和释放等)。       java的开发环境为JDK(包含JRE用户时候用的时候只需要JRE) 2java的两种核心机       1java虚拟机:屏蔽了...
分类:编程语言   时间:2015-05-31 20:10:13    收藏:0  评论:0  赞:0  阅读:318
汇编语言学习随笔
1.可执行文件中包含两部分内容:*程序(从源程序中的汇编指令翻译过来的机器码)和数据(源程序中定义的数据)*相关的描述信息(比如程序有多大,占多少内存空间啊等等)2.segment和ends是一对成对使用的伪指令,伪指令不能被cpu识别,而是给编译器看的。伪指令end是一个汇编程序的结束标记,编译器...
分类:编程语言   时间:2015-05-31 20:06:33    收藏:0  评论:0  赞:0  阅读:263
JavaScript基于原型的继承
在一个纯粹的原型模式中,我们会摒弃类,转而专注于对象,基于原型的继承相比基于类的继承的概念上更为简单if( typeof Object.beget !== 'function'){ Object.beget = function(o) { var F = fun...
分类:编程语言   时间:2015-05-31 20:06:23    收藏:0  评论:0  赞:0  阅读:284
Python Django 的 django templatedoesnotexist
django 1.8版本的解决方案在 setting.py 这个文件里TEMPLATES = [ ...... #原来的 #'DIRS': [ ], // 这个 列表里添加 template路径 #修改后 'DIR...
分类:编程语言   时间:2015-05-31 20:05:03    收藏:0  评论:0  赞:0  阅读:277
[LeetCode][JavaScript]ZigZag Conversion
ZigZag ConversionThe string"PAYPALISHIRING"is written in a zigzag pattern on a given number of rows like this: (you may want to display this pattern i...
分类:编程语言   时间:2015-05-31 20:00:53    收藏:0  评论:0  赞:0  阅读:225
JAVA 对象的转型
/*对象的转型:1、对象的向上转型 子类转成父类 默认进行 父类引用指向子类对象2、对象的向下转型 父类转成子类 强制进行关键字:instanceof 测试左边对象是否是右边类的实例 如果是返回true 不是返回false*/class Animal{ void sleep(){ ...
分类:编程语言   时间:2015-05-31 19:58:53    收藏:0  评论:0  赞:0  阅读:225
翻译《Writing Idiomatic Python》(五):类、上下文管理器、生成器
原书参考:http://www.jeffknupp.com/blog/2012/10/04/writing-idiomatic-python/上一篇:翻译《Writing Idiomatic Python》(四):字典、集合、元组下一篇:TO BE UPDATED..2.7 类2.7.1 用isin...
分类:编程语言   时间:2015-05-31 19:57:53    收藏:0  评论:0  赞:0  阅读:263
关于C语言: 初始化一个指向数组的指针变量为什么不需要&符号?
C语言中数组名就是第一个元素的地址,所以可以直接把它赋给一个指针,不需要取地址。1 void InitBiTree(SqBiTree T)2 { // 构造空二叉树T。因为T是数组名,故不需要&3 int i;4 for(i=0;i<MAX_TREE_SIZE;i++)5 ...
分类:编程语言   时间:2015-05-31 19:56:13    收藏:0  评论:0  赞:0  阅读:338
java 访问活动目录代码
package demo; import java.util.Hashtable; import javax.naming.Context; import javax.naming.NamingEnumeration; import javax.naming.NamingException; imp...
分类:编程语言   时间:2015-05-31 19:56:03    收藏:0  评论:0  赞:0  阅读:249
【学习笔记】【C语言】变量的内存分析
1. 字节和地址为了更好地理解变量在内存中的存储细节,先来认识一下内存中的“字节”和“地址”。1> 内存以“字节为单位”0x表示的是十六进制,不用过于纠结,能看懂这些数字之间谁大谁小就行了2> 不同类型占用的字节是不一样的,数据越大,所需的字节数就越多2. 变量的存储1> 所占用字节数跟类型有关,也...
分类:编程语言   时间:2015-05-31 19:55:53    收藏:0  评论:0  赞:0  阅读:286
出现java.lang.NoSuchFieldException resourceEntries错误的解决方法
JSP表单里面的表单输入这里面的每一个输入都是一个Attribute,相当于setAttribute("name",user);如果是提交到Action里面,则需要相应的Action有对应的同名变量定义和setter/getter方法,即使你没有用它做任何操作。Action里面的提供Setter/G...
分类:编程语言   时间:2015-05-31 19:54:33    收藏:0  评论:0  赞:8  阅读:20835
Python 可变对象与不可变对象
1、不可变(immutable):int、字符串(string)、float、(数值型number)、元组(tuple)可变(mutable):字典型(dictionary)、列表型(list)>>>person=['name',['saving',100]]>>>ly=person[:]>>> z...
分类:编程语言   时间:2015-05-31 19:54:03    收藏:0  评论:0  赞:0  阅读:193
c++学习笔记:hello world
第一个c++程序“hello world” 作为一名学习c++的学生,很荣幸与大家一起分享我的学习历程。 从哪里下手呢?就从鼎鼎大名的“hello world”开始好了。代码如下://使用的是Linux下的vi编辑器进行源代码的输入,编译、链接使用的是gcc编译器。VC6与VS可以参考自己的编译.....
分类:编程语言   时间:2015-05-31 19:52:33    收藏:0  评论:0  赞:0  阅读:304
Python高级编程–正则表达式(习题)
原文:http://start2join.me/python-regex-answer-20141030/####################################################Exercises after Chapter 15th ################...
分类:编程语言   时间:2015-05-31 19:52:13    收藏:0  评论:0  赞:0  阅读:437
C语言调试的几种方法
linux系统下,在不gdb调试的情况下,我们如何解决程序崩溃问题呢?首先想到的就是添加log日志信息,其次还有以下几种方法可以帮助我们分析存在的问题:(一)add2line 程序崩溃时会打出一些崩溃地方的地址空间,可以使用此方法显示崩溃地方对应的函数或者某一行,使用方法如下:echo "0x63d...
分类:编程语言   时间:2015-05-31 19:50:13    收藏:0  评论:0  赞:0  阅读:320
python str.translate()函数用法
Pythontranslate()方法描述Pythontranslate()方法根据参数table给出的表(包含256个字符)转换字符串的字符,要过滤掉的字符放到del参数中。语法translate()方法语法:str.translate(table[,deletechars]);参数table--翻译表,翻译表是通过maketrans方法转换而来。deletechars--字..
分类:编程语言   时间:2015-05-31 18:46:34    收藏:0  评论:0  赞:0  阅读:481
Java语法错误之-执行不到的代码
在java中,不允许写入执行不到的代码,这样的错误大概分为以下几种情况:return在return后面的语句,视为无效代码。throw在直接用throw抛出异常后面的代码,视为无效代码。catch当有多个catch块,并且它们之间有继承关系时,如果父类catch块在前面,后面的子类catch块会视为无..
分类:编程语言   时间:2015-05-31 18:45:34    收藏:0  评论:0  赞:0  阅读:290
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!